Question 1178720: Mary says that the graph of 3x^2 + 5x + 9
y = ----------------
x^2 + 2x - 7

will approach y = 1 as the x-values approach both positive and negative infinity. Is Mary correct?

No. Think about it. The lead terms of both numerator and denominator become increasingly important for x going either extreme to the right or to the left...
